Handover: Tove → Brannick. Upgraded the Quenchport broker from v4 to v6. Plugin authors: wire protocol changed, so rebuild against the v6 shim. Legacy queues drain automatically over two weeks. Dead-letter handling is stricter now — test your retries. The staging broker's admin console unlocks with the recovery passphrase below.

vault phrase of taweg-kafof = oliax-zorael

Hi Priya — quick handover before I'm off. The pool car keys live in the grey cabinet by the loading bay door at Hollis Court. Log every key out and back in the yellow book on top; Facilities audits it monthly. Fuel cards are in the same cabinet, left drawer. If a key goes missing, tell Marcus in Fleet straight away. The cabinet code is below.

staff pass of haweg-bafop = bdg-G-69

Handover Note — Director Transition

As I hand the portfolio to Renata Quillon, the main open item is the retirement of the Ashfell product line. Final production ends next quarter; spare-parts support continues for two years. Customer communications are drafted but unsent. Department heads should hold messaging until the confidential plan below is confirmed.

confidential, kagep-kahof: Druokax Systems plans to lower the Ulaath list price by 53 percent in March.

Changed defaults in Splitfork, our assignment service. Bucketing now uses sticky hashing per account instead of per session, and the holdout slice grew from 2% to 5%. Callers relying on session-level reassignment must opt in explicitly. Review the diff against the new baseline; the updated default configuration is listed below.

config for tagep-kajof:
[casir]
port = 6379
region = south-1
host = casir.paliqdyn.example
team = tamax
timeout_ms = 250
retries = 2